It seems that Apple just keeps popping them out, and while it might seem a little early in the year for the typical announcement of the next iPhone, Apple's due date might’ve been pushed forward for a surprise sibling. Tim Cook has confirmed that the tech company is 'with child', as an upcoming Apple reveal will show off the newest member of the family.

Affectionately known as 'Tim Apple' by President Donald Trump, Cook has been the company CEO since 2011 and had some pretty big shoes to fill in the aftermath of Steve Jobs' tragic passing.

Still, Cook has helped Apple grow to become one of the biggest companies in the world - reporting a jaw-dropping revenue of $391.04 billion in 2024.

Despite some complaints about Apple Intelligence and the typical grumbles that every new iOS update zaps our phone battery, Apple is looking ahead at an even bigger 2025. Hoping to bolster its earnings, Cook has promised a new product will be revealed on February 19.

Set to some cheerful background music, Cook's simple post said: "Get ready to meet the newest member of the family. Wednesday, February 19. #AppleLaunch."

Even though it seems like he's given nothing away, eagle-eyed tech fans are diving into theories about what the post might suggest.

Due to a circular ring around the Apple logo, some think it could be hinting at the rumored HomePod mini 2 or a new AirTag (which is also round).

However, many think it doesn't take a genius to figure out what's coming on February 19.

Rumors point to a fourth-generation iPhone SE being the latest addition (Bloomberg / Contributor / Getty)
Rumors point to a fourth-generation iPhone SE being the latest addition (Bloomberg / Contributor / Getty)

Bloomberg's Tim Gurman came straight out and said it, claiming that Cook's cryptic announcement is gearing up for the long-awaited reveal of the fourth-generation iPhone SE.

The silver cutout and backplate have many thinking of the original iPhone SE that launched back in 2016, but then again, we could be overthinking things.

Although the iPhone SE is typically thought of as a 'budget' version of the iPhone, various leaks have hinted at a more advanced model that could include dual cameras, Face ID, and a 6.1-inch OLED screen.

We recently reported that the fourth-generation iPhone SE could be on sale in a matter of days, but following Cook's announcement, it looks increasingly likely we'll have to wait a little longer.

Importantly, it's key to note that we aren't getting a full Apple showcase, meaning this looks like the launch of a singular product instead of a new line. You're almost definitely going to have to wait until September for an official glimpse of the iPhone 17.

Launching a new iPhone SE sooner rather than later can only be good for business, especially as the European Union mandate for USB-C charging ports means no SE models are currently on sale in the EA. Thankfully, there isn't long to wait until we know what's on the way.
